Er … Senator Byrd was most emphatically not a “stalwart supporter” of these civil rights bills. In fact, he voted (and participated in filibusters) against them. In the face of such ignorance, Doug Powers provides a useful history lesson on the record of the Dems on the Civil Rights Act of 1964:

House of Representatives:
Democrats for: 152
Democrats against: 96
Republicans for: 138
Republicans against: 34

Senate:
Democrats for: 46
Democrats against: 21
Republicans for: 27
Republicans against: 6

For any progressive who might be reading this, this means that only 63% of the Dems voted for the bill, while 80% of the Republicans supported it. Which is what any historically literate reader would expect. The Dems were always the party of white supremacy, which is why they welcomed Robert Byrd.
